Overview Meteor Madness Challenge is an innovative AI-powered educational platform that transforms space science learning into an engaging interactive adventure. This project gamifies meteor exploration to make complex astronomical concepts accessible and exciting.

Inspiration: Inspiration: Our site is entirely programmed by AI. Through it, we aim to demonstrate the capabilities of AI to younger generations and society at large. Trained strictly on authentic NASA data, our project ensures scientific accuracy while unlocking new perspectives. We also want to showcase that imagination and creativity have no limits, and that in today’s era, with the power of AI, anyone with an idea can bring it to life more easily than ever before.

The universe poses an existential threat that few people understand—asteroid and meteor impacts. From the extinction-level Chicxulub impact 66 million years ago to the 2013 Chelyabinsk meteor airburst, celestial bodies continuously threaten Earth. Yet public awareness remains critically low, and planetary defense remains largely unknown.

Core Features:

  1. Interactive 3D Asteroid Viewer

    • Rotatable, inspectable 3D asteroid models rendered with WebGL/Three.js
    • Hover-to-explore interface with silky smooth animations
    • Real-time orbital visualization and trajectory simulation
    • Intuitive controls optimized for all devices
  2. Arthurite AI Assistant — Intelligent Chatbot

    • Powered by Google Gemini AI with custom planetary defense training
    • Contextual educational responses (75-150 words) optimized for learning
    • Safeguarded to ensure scientifically accurate, non-emergency guidance
    • Multi-language support-ready architecture
    • Real-time response streaming
  3. Progressive Learning Path

    • Introduction Module — Fundamentals of asteroids, meteors, and comets
    • Detection Module — Modern detection technologies and early-warning systems
    • History Module — Past impact events with detailed analysis
    • Defense Module — Cutting-edge planetary defense technologies
    • Simulation Module — Real-time asteroid collision simulations
  4. Immersive UI/UX

    • Glass morphism design with cutting-edge CSS backdrop-blur effects
    • Smooth page transitions (cubic-bezier easing)
    • Custom animated cursor with halo effects for premium feel
    • Particle background systems and cosmic visual elements
    • Fully responsive across desktop, tablet, and mobile
    • Accessibility-first design principles
  5. Multimedia Integration

    • Immersive soundscapes and UI audio feedback
    • Authentic meteor imagery (Chelyabinsk, Sikhote-Alin, Tunguska)
    • 3D model assets (GLTF/GLB format for optimal performance)
    • Background ambient music for atmospheric immersion

Key Feature: Interactive Learning - Real-time Analytics: Comprehensive performance tracking Gamification - Mission Challenges: Meteor hunting, impact prediction, space survival - Technical Excellence - 95% Automation: AI-driven programming - Immersive Design: Space-themed UI with animated elements

Educational Impact - Master meteor science and planetary formation - Identify meteor compositions and mineral structures - 300% participation increase goal through gamification.

How We Built It

Tech Stack:

Frontend:

  • HTML5 / CSS3 (modern glassmorphism, animations)
  • Three.js — High-performance 3D asteroid rendering
  • GSAP — Smooth animation library
  • Custom JavaScript — Responsive UI, cursor effects, audio management

Backend:

  • Node.js + Express — Lightweight REST API server
  • Google Gemini API — State-of-the-art LLM for educational AI
  • CORS + Environment Management — Secure, production-ready setup

Design & Media:

  • Figma prototyping (glass morphism components)
  • Blender 3D modeling
  • Web Audio API for interactive sound effects

Data Sources:

  • NASA official asteroid database
  • NASA planetary defense research
  • Published asteroid mission data (OSIRIS-REx, Hayabusa2, DART)

Architecture Highlights:

Scalable Microservices — Separation of 3D rendering, AI logic, and UI
Progressive Enhancement — Works with fallbacks for older browsers
Optimized Bundle Sizes — Lazy-loaded 3D models and assets
Real-time Analytics — Visitor tracking without compromising privacy
Error Handling & Graceful Degradation — Robust AudioContext management, network error recovery


"The universe doesn't ask permission. Neither should education." 🌌🚀

Built With

Share this project:

Updates